Meaning & origin

Korrina is a modern, respelled variation of Corina, likely inspired by the Greek name Korinna meaning 'maiden'. It first appeared in U.S. data in 1961 and reached its peak popularity in 1996, after which its usage has steadily declined through 2025. Although it has never entered the top 1,000 names, Korrina reflects the trend toward distinctively spelled 'K' names that became fashionable in the late 20th century. As a name of modern origin, it carries no centuries-old tradition but offers a fresh, feminine sound similar to other 'ina' endings like Katrina or Karina. Its falling trajectory since 1995 suggests it is becoming less common, appealing to parents who prefer rare names without widespread usage.

Korrina is a modern English respelling of the name Corina or Corinne. Corina is a variant of Corinne, which derives from the Greek name Korinna, itself from the Greek word 'kore' meaning 'maiden' or 'girl'. The spelling with a 'K' emerged in the late 20th century as part of a trend for distinctive 'K' names. The name first entered U.S. records in 1961, peaking in popularity in 1996 before declining.

Questions parents ask

What does the name Korrina mean?
Korrina is likely a modern respelling of Corina, which derives from the Greek word 'kore' meaning 'maiden'. However, its exact meaning is uncertain.
How popular is the name Korrina?
Korrina never ranked in the top 1,000 U.S. names. It peaked in 1996, and its use has been falling since 1995. As of 2025, no rank or 1-in-N data is available.
Is Korrina a boy or girl name?
Korrina is almost exclusively used for girls.
